1. Suitable module: BW16
2. Antenna type: onboard PCB Antenna
3. Spectrum range: 2400-2483.5MHz or 5180-5825MHz
4. WiFi: supports 802.11a/b/g/n
5. Bluetooth: BLE 5.0
6. Power supply: 5V, Current > 500mA
7. Security: AES/DES/SHA
8. Flash memory: 4MB
9. Supported protocols: 802.11 a/b/g/n, Dual-Band (2.4GHz and 5GHz)
10. Transmit power: 2.4GHz: 16dBm (11b), 15dBm (11g), 14dBm (11n) 5GHz: 14dBm (11a), 13dBm (11n) (based on the open-source project FlipperZero-WiFi-Scanner_Module)
11. Real-time 5G channel strength scanning (dynamic display from -60dBm to -75dBm)
12. Dual-band sniffing algorithm, supporting intelligent switching between 2.4GHz and 5GHz bands
13. Compatible with WPA2 encryption protocol only (KRACK defense firmware pre-installed)
14. Open API interface, supporting Arduino/PlatformIO secondary development
15. Accompanying App supports multiple target SSIDs (including signal strength/encryption type visualization)
